From patchwork Tue Mar 31 18:39:37 2015 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Tyler Baker X-Patchwork-Id: 46603 Return-Path: X-Original-To: linaro@patches.linaro.org Delivered-To: linaro@patches.linaro.org Received: from mail-la0-f70.google.com (mail-la0-f70.google.com [209.85.215.70]) by ip-10-151-82-157.ec2.internal (Postfix) with ESMTPS id 1BCC2216E5 for ; Tue, 31 Mar 2015 18:39:52 +0000 (UTC) Received: by labtp8 with SMTP id tp8sf5989421lab.2 for ; Tue, 31 Mar 2015 11:39:51 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:delivered-to:mime-version:date:message-id :subject:from:to:cc:content-type:sender:precedence:list-id :x-original-sender:x-original-authentication-results:mailing-list :list-post:list-help:list-archive:list-unsubscribe; bh=0q3c3kNKza49hS9SXUqJ1swwYsDHZkhCg2S+3sqPDzI=; b=KhqGPT+QqK4NlBnPtSqtyL/38gKyQma2gIXIaeBCeWTHzTNXcdCNyPzXCJO9M8qMHm xKT0rC48wtsUo/ziaAAlLiGeO6hak5CSnxoE2YA3d3uwmKZArQ4S1ZXXkUPwfMiZidZa r9EJBNeK5ZaNGRcl+rAgKKEoXugUhIs5Fat2T5oDyeEeNBDnSloJ8VevInQpZdhNROmC 1KiVoAKYckmdgkaGcOOTCYVVicddjm38KJYLOaIKMQLpN3TLaeadHXgjsW23WODxFjYl pHuZWN5NTrN2dCdyHrrd/V0KlKKfHewl5q20bD3T+TupeXwm5B1PCJLEKKDnA0/MQHRm hB6w== X-Gm-Message-State: ALoCoQnniidHGHGRo/OcTUEgbV4MjPgbzc7vEzWXZGyDM++9jzdLzCKKymJIVx78XIqROjr0UmVy X-Received: by 10.180.80.132 with SMTP id r4mr1001213wix.4.1427827191092; Tue, 31 Mar 2015 11:39:51 -0700 (PDT) X-BeenThere: patchwork-forward@linaro.org Received: by 10.152.36.199 with SMTP id s7ls603785laj.57.gmail; Tue, 31 Mar 2015 11:39:50 -0700 (PDT) X-Received: by 10.152.27.225 with SMTP id w1mr27164098lag.77.1427827190897; Tue, 31 Mar 2015 11:39:50 -0700 (PDT) Received: from mail-la0-f46.google.com (mail-la0-f46.google.com. [209.85.215.46]) by mx.google.com with ESMTPS id n5si9761177laj.150.2015.03.31.11.39.50 for (version=TLSv1.2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 31 Mar 2015 11:39:50 -0700 (PDT) Received-SPF: pass (google.com: domain of patch+caf_=patchwork-forward=linaro.org@linaro.org designates 209.85.215.46 as permitted sender) client-ip=209.85.215.46; Received: by lagg8 with SMTP id g8so19671265lag.1 for ; Tue, 31 Mar 2015 11:39:50 -0700 (PDT) X-Received: by 10.152.23.70 with SMTP id k6mr3431349laf.76.1427827190744; Tue, 31 Mar 2015 11:39:50 -0700 (PDT) X-Forwarded-To: patchwork-forward@linaro.org X-Forwarded-For: patch@linaro.org patchwork-forward@linaro.org Delivered-To: patch@linaro.org Received: by 10.112.57.201 with SMTP id k9csp169568lbq; Tue, 31 Mar 2015 11:39:50 -0700 (PDT) X-Received: by 10.69.0.106 with SMTP id ax10mr70678199pbd.11.1427827189075; Tue, 31 Mar 2015 11:39:49 -0700 (PDT)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id uv6si20484299pbc.34.2015.03.31.11.39.47; Tue, 31 Mar 2015 11:39:49 -0700 (PDT) Received-SPF: none (google.com: linux-kernel-owner@vger.kernel.org does not designate permitted sender hosts) client-ip=209.132.180.67;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753877AbbCaSjm (ORCPT + 27 others); Tue, 31 Mar 2015 14:39:42 -0400 Received: from mail-wg0-f53.google.com ([74.125.82.53]:33728 "EHLO mail-wg0-f53.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752292AbbCaSji (ORCPT ); Tue, 31 Mar 2015 14:39:38 -0400 Received: by wgoe14 with SMTP id e14so28924839wgo.0 for ; Tue, 31 Mar 2015 11:39:37 -0700 (PDT) MIME-Version: 1.0 X-Received: by 10.180.182.67 with SMTP id ec3mr7881583wic.32.1427827177552; Tue, 31 Mar 2015 11:39:37 -0700 (PDT) Received: by 10.27.231.6 with HTTP; Tue, 31 Mar 2015 11:39:37 -0700 (PDT) Date: Tue, 31 Mar 2015 11:39:37 -0700 Message-ID: Subject: Build regression in next-20150331 From: Tyler Baker To: Thomas Gleixner , rafael.j.wysocki@intel.com Cc: John Stultz , "linux-kernel@vger.kernel.org" , linux-arm-kernel , Kevin Hilman Sender: linux-kernel-owner@vger.kernel.org Precedence: list List-ID: X-Mailing-List: linux-kernel@vger.kernel.org X-Removed-Original-Auth: Dkim didn't pass. X-Original-Sender: tyler.baker@linaro.org X-Original-Authentication-Results: mx.google.com; spf=pass (google.com: domain of patch+caf_=patchwork-forward=linaro.org@linaro.org designates 209.85.215.46 as permitted sender) smtp.mail=patch+caf_=patchwork-forward=linaro.org@linaro.org Mailing-list: list patchwork-forward@linaro.org; contact patchwork-forward+owners@linaro.org X-Google-Group-Id: 836684582541 List-Post: , List-Help: , List-Archive: List-Unsubscribe: , Hi Thomas, Rafael, I was notified this morning by the kernelci.org system that a new build error has been detected in next-20150331[0][1][2]. It seems that "clockevents: Remove CONFIG_GENERIC_CLOCKEVENTS_BUILD" c9439b1d6eb4ada5c2faf3970ac0d2bc4bd20e14 is the culprit. Initially, I reported these failures to John Stultz and his response is below. *snip* I suspect we either need to enable GENERIC_CLOCKEVENTS on those three hardware types, or if that's not possible, rework the definitions. Or something like (copy-paste whitespace corruption below.. only for reference, don't apply): *snip* Any chance either of you can reproduce this issue on your end? Cheers, Tyler [0] http://storage.kernelci.org/next/next-20150331/arm-ep93xx_defconfig/build.log [1] http://storage.kernelci.org/next/next-20150331/arm-ebsa110_defconfig/build.log [2] http://storage.kernelci.org/next/next-20150331/arm-rpc_defconfig/build.log ---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/ diff --git a/kernel/time/tick-internal.h b/kernel/time/tick-internal.h index 2a1563a..6da40c0 100644 --- a/kernel/time/tick-internal.h +++ b/kernel/time/tick-internal.h @@ -107,12 +107,13 @@ static inline void tick_resume_broadcast(void) { } static inline bool tick_resume_check_broadcast(void) { return false; } static inline void tick_broadcast_init(void) { } static inline int tick_broadcast_update_freq(struct clock_event_device *dev, u32 freq) { return -ENODEV; } - +#ifdef CONFIG_GENERIC_CLOCKEVENTS /* Set the periodic handler in non broadcast mode */ static inline void tick_set_periodic_handler(struct clock_event_device *dev, int broadcast) { dev->event_handler = tick_handle_periodic; } +#endif #endif /* !BROADCAST */